Ticket: Staging env misconfigured for Siftgate bloom filter

The bloom layer in front of the Pellet KV store is rejecting all lookups in staging because the env file was copied from the dev template without credentials. False-positive tuning values are fine; only the auth line is missing. To unblock the weekly demo, the Pellet admission secret must be set on the following line.

env line for yaguf-fajop: LEDGER_TOKEN13=fb08984397349

**Action item 4 (owner: release manager):** The Pixelfold CLI shipped 2.8 with a broken --max-workers flag because our release checklist doesn't actually run the batch-resize smoke test — it just links to it. Let's fix that: make the smoke test a blocking step in the release pipeline, not a suggestion. Also add a quick sanity run against the big sample folder, since that's exactly what caught fire for the Larchview customer. The updated checklist draft is already up on the internal wiki page below.

wiki page, tahaf-tajog: https://jira.ordindyn.corp/pipeline

# Build Provenance — TideGlance Widget

All TideGlance builds come from the Marrowport pipeline. Artifacts are signed at the packaging stage; unsigned builds must never ship. To verify provenance during an incident: pull the manifest from the artifact store, confirm the signer is the Marrowport release key, and match timestamps against the deploy log. Rollbacks require the same check. Do not trust version strings alone — they are user-editable. The canonical identifier for the currently deployed build is the token on the line below.

pipeline stamp: htk4_ae36

- [ ] Flagwright key ceremony, step 7: after both custodians have inserted their shares, the rollout-signing key for the Flagwright feature-flag framework gets re-sealed. Heads up, contractor folks — don't skip the verification read-back, even if Marisol says it's fine. Once the seal confirms, the ceremony tool asks for the recovery passphrase to bind the backup shard. Type it exactly as it appears on the line below.

strongbox words: zordor-quenax